很多新手朋友對PyCharm的使用無從下手,於是花費了一點時間整理這份PyCharm操作手冊,
完整PDF下載: 終於寫完了!PyCharm操作手冊 V1.0版本 PDF下載
目錄如下:
2021年最新PyCharm使用教程 --- 1、PyCharm的下載與安裝
2021年最新PyCharm使用教程 --- 4、界面/菜單欄介紹
2021年最新PyCharm使用教程 --- 5、PyCharm的基本配置
2021年最新PyCharm使用教程 --- 7、使用PyCharm進行DeBug調試
2021年最新PyCharm使用教程 --- 9、PyCharm中的搜索技巧(文件/函數/內容)
2021年最新PyCharm使用教程 ---10、PyCharm實用小技巧
2021年最新PyCharm使用教程 --- 11、PyCharm必備插件
界面介紹
從大的方向來看PyCharm分為 菜單欄區域 / 項目結構區域 / 代碼區域 / 運行信息區
菜單欄
提示:菜單欄 快捷鍵為
Alt + 首字母
,比如File
的快捷鍵Alt + F
,Edit
的快捷鍵Alt +E
1、File(文件)
-
New Project
: 創建新的項目 -
New ...
:新建一些中間件配置,如MySQL、MongoDB、DDL等以及相關驅動 -
New Scratch File
:划痕文檔,也稱為臨時文件,可以創建各種類型的文件進行臨時處理,在里面“打草稿”,可運行並且可調試(非常棒的一個功能,在最近的版本才有的) -
Open
:打開項目目錄 -
Save as
: 另存為 -
Close Project
:關閉項目並回答創建項目頁面 -
Rename Project
:給項目重命名 -
Settings
:設置選項,重點☆☆☆☆☆ -
File Properties
: 文件的相關屬性,包括編碼等 -
Invalidate Caches /Restart..
: 是緩存失效,並重啟
2、Edit(編輯)
-
Find
: 編輯窗口中用的最多的就是Find選項中的,例如Ctrl + F
文件內查找,Ctrl +Shift + F
項目中搜索,以及Ctrl + R
文件內替換,Ctrl+Shift+R
全文替換(慎用!)windows下ctrl+shift+F快捷鍵如果無效,大概率是因為裝了搜狗輸入法,快捷鍵沖突導致的。只需要修改輸入法中對應的快捷鍵即可,或者修改PyCharm的快捷鍵。
3、View(視圖)
Tool Windows
: 工具窗口,如果主頁面中某些窗口不小心關了,可以在這里面重新找到。Appearance:
:外觀設置,除了基本的布局調整,最強大的莫過於這四種模式(在閱讀代碼的時候真的很爽!)
Enter/Exit Presentation Mode:進入/退出 展示模式
Enter/Exit Distraction Free Mode:進入/退出 免打擾模式
Enter/Exit Full Screen:進入/退出 全屏模式
Enter/Exit Zen Mode:進入/退出 禪模式(一個終極模式,包含以上3種模式)
其次Toolbar
也是一個不錯的功能,開啟之后,會在菜單欄有一個導航
-
Recent Files:
: 最近打開的文件,快捷鍵Ctrl + E
-
Recent Locations
:最近修改的內容 -
Compare With:
:比較文件之間的差異 -
Compare with Cliboard:
與剪切板上的內容做比較
4、Code(編碼)
-
Code Completion:
代碼補全,不過可以進行全局設置,每次敲入字母時會自動提示進行補全設置步驟如下:
File -> settings
在同樣的窗口,可以設置忽略大小寫補全
-
Insert Live Template:
快速插入模板。默認模板,路徑
File -> Settings
,也可以通過點擊+
號 自己添加以上面的
flask
下的route
為例,寫代碼時,直接輸入route
就可以完成預先設置的模板內容了 -
surround With:
將選擇的代碼進行包裹,如if/while/for/try..catch
包裹住。快捷鍵Ctrl +Alt + T
-
Reformat Code:
格式化代碼,快捷鍵Ctrl +Alt +L
-
Auto-Indent Lines
: 自動縮進,快捷鍵Ctrl + Alt + I
-
Move Statement/Line Down/Up:
向上向下移動,快捷鍵Ctrl +Shift + 向上箭頭/向下箭頭
5、Refactor(重構)
Refactor This..:
重構當前Rename:
重命名,快捷鍵Shift + F6
Move:
移動文件,快捷鍵F6
Copy:
拷貝文件,快捷鍵F5
Safe Detele:
安全刪除,快速刪除py文件,快捷鍵Alt + Delete
6、Run
Run 'xxx':
運行當前文件Debug 'xxx':
通過Debug模式運行該文件Run 'xxx' with Coverage:
以統計覆蓋的形式運行當前文件Run ...:
選擇文件運行Debug ...:
選擇文件Debug運行Edit Configurations..:
編輯配置內容
1、Name:可以自己隨意起名
2、Script Path: 項目的文件路徑
3、Python interpreter:Python解釋器的路徑
4、Workding directory:項目路徑
7、Tools(工具)
保存一些文件/項目模板。
8、VCS(版本控制)
Enable Version Control Integration:
選擇相應的版本控制工具VCS Operation:
版本控制操作窗口Get from Version Control... :
從版本控制中獲取(比如從GitHub上導入項目時,可在這個模塊中完成)
9、Window(窗體)
Store Current Layout as Default:
存儲當前PyCharm布局Restore Default Layout:
窗口布局復位(有時候窗口比較亂的時候,可以進行還原)其他補充:
主要就是控制窗口布局,以及tab顯示的
10、Help
-
Find Action:
通過鍵入快捷鍵喚出想要的功能(非常強大,適合鍵盤流) -
Keymap Reference:
查看快捷鍵清單() -
Tip of the Day:
PyCharm的每日小技巧 -
Edit Custom Properties:
在idea.properties中添加個人配置 -
Edit Custom VM Options:
在pycharm64.exe.vmoptions中添加啟動配置 -
Register:
注冊 -
Check for Update:
檢查更新